phpcms站点目录结构详解

“phpcms站点目录结构详解”是一篇详细介绍phpcms网站目录结构的文章。本文从根目录开始,逐层解析了phpcms网站的各个文件夹和文件的作用和功能。通过阅读本文,读者能够了解到phpcms网站搭建的

“phpcms站点目录结构详解”是一篇详细介绍phpcms网站目录结构的文章。本文从根目录开始,逐层解析了phpcms网站的各个文件夹和文件的作用和功能。通过阅读本文,读者能够了解到phpcms网站搭建的基本原理和目录结构,为开发者和网站管理员提供了宝贵的参考和指导。无论是初学者还是有一定经验的开发者,都能从本文中获得实用的知识和技巧,帮助他们更好地搭建和管理phpcms网站。

1、phpcms站点目录结构详解

phpcms站点目录结构详解

phpcms站点目录结构详解

phpcms是一款基于PHP语言开发的内容管理系统,它提供了一套完整的网站建设解决方案。在使用phpcms进行网站开发时,了解其目录结构是非常重要的。本文将详细介绍phpcms站点目录结构。

1. 根目录(ROOT)

根目录是整个phpcms站点的起始目录,它包含了一些必要的文件和目录。在根目录下,我们可以找到以下几个重要的文件和目录:

- index.php:这是网站的入口文件,所有的请求都会通过该文件进行处理。

- api:该目录用于存放一些API接口文件,用于处理与其他系统的数据交互。

- cache:该目录用于存放一些缓存文件,提高网站的访问速度。

- config:该目录存放了网站的配置文件,包括数据库配置、站点配置等。

- template:该目录用于存放网站的模板文件,包括前台和后台的模板。

2. 应用目录(APP)

应用目录是phpcms的核心目录之一,它包含了网站的核心代码和功能模块。在应用目录下,我们可以找到以下几个重要的子目录:

- controllers:该目录用于存放控制器文件,控制器负责处理用户请求和调用模型进行数据处理。

- models:该目录用于存放模型文件,模型负责与数据库进行交互,获取和处理数据。

- views:该目录用于存放视图文件,视图负责展示数据和与用户进行交互。

3. 数据库目录(DATABASE)

数据库目录存放了网站的数据库文件,其中包括了网站的数据表结构和默认数据。在数据库目录下,我们可以找到以下几个重要的文件:

- install.sql:该文件用于安装phpcms时创建数据库表和插入默认数据。

- update.sql:该文件用于升级phpcms时更新数据库表结构和数据。

4. 扩展目录(EXTENSION)

扩展目录用于存放网站的扩展功能模块。在扩展目录下,我们可以找到以下几个重要的子目录:

- module:该目录用于存放扩展模块的代码文件,包括控制器、模型和视图。

- statics:该目录用于存放扩展模块的静态资源文件,如CSS、JavaScript和图片等。

5. 其他目录

除了上述主要目录外,phpcms还包含一些其他目录,如attachment目录用于存放上传的附件文件,html目录用于存放生成的静态HTML文件等。

以上就是phpcms站点目录结构的详细介绍。了解phpcms的目录结构对于网站开发和维护都非常重要,它能够帮助开发人员更好地组织和管理网站的代码和资源文件。希望本文能够对读者有所帮助,更好地理解和使用phpcms。

2、站点栏目结构

站点栏目结构

站点栏目结构是指网站上各个栏目的组织结构和布局。一个合理的站点栏目结构对于提高用户体验、增加网站流量和提升搜索引擎排名都非常重要。本文将从站点栏目结构的意义、设计原则以及常见的结构类型等方面进行介绍。

站点栏目结构的意义在于帮助用户快速准确地找到所需信息。一个清晰的站点栏目结构能够使用户在浏览网站时不会迷失方向,提高用户的满意度和留存率。良好的栏目结构也有助于搜索引擎的索引和收录,提高网站的可见度和排名。

在设计站点栏目结构时,有几个原则需要遵循。要根据网站的内容和目标受众来确定栏目的分类。分类应该具有明确的逻辑关系,使用户能够轻松理解和使用。要保持栏目的层级结构简洁明了,不要设计过多的层级,以免让用户感到困惑和疲惫。要注重栏目之间的内部链接,使用户能够方便地在不同栏目之间进行跳转,提高用户的导航体验。

常见的站点栏目结构类型包括线性结构、分支结构和混合结构。线性结构是最简单的结构类型,栏目之间呈线性排列,适用于内容较少、层级较浅的网站。分支结构是将栏目按照主题或功能进行分类,每个栏目下面可以有多个子栏目,适用于内容较多、层级较深的网站。混合结构是将线性结构和分支结构相结合,根据具体情况进行设计,适用于内容较多、层级较复杂的网站。

除了以上几种结构类型,还可以根据网站的特点和需求进行定制化的栏目结构设计。例如,可以根据用户的浏览习惯和需求来设计个性化的栏目结构,提供更加精准的内容推荐。可以根据不同设备的屏幕尺寸和分辨率来设计响应式的栏目结构,提供更好的移动端用户体验。

站点栏目结构在网站设计中起着至关重要的作用。一个合理的栏目结构能够提高用户体验、增加网站流量和提升搜索引擎排名。在设计栏目结构时,需要遵循一些原则,并根据具体情况选择适合的结构类型。随着技术的不断发展和用户需求的变化,栏目结构的设计也需要不断优化和调整,以适应不同的场景和用户需求。

3、php站点怎么建立

php站点怎么建立

PHP站点怎么建立

PHP(Hypertext Preprocessor)是一种广泛使用的服务器端脚本语言,特别适用于Web开发。建立一个PHP站点并不复杂,只需几个简单的步骤。本文将为您介绍如何建立一个PHP站点。

第一步是选择合适的开发环境。PHP站点的建立需要一个服务器和一个数据库。最常用的服务器是Apache,而MySQL是最受欢迎的数据库。您可以选择在本地搭建开发环境,也可以选择使用云服务器。

第二步是安装所需的软件。如果选择在本地搭建开发环境,您需要下载并安装Apache服务器和MySQL数据库。这些软件都有官方网站提供下载,并且有详细的安装指南。按照指南一步一步操作,即可完成安装。

第三步是配置服务器和数据库。在安装完成后,您需要对服务器和数据库进行一些配置。例如,您需要指定服务器的根目录和端口号,以及数据库的用户名和密码。这些配置文件通常可以在安装目录中找到,并且有注释说明如何进行配置。

第四步是编写PHP代码。PHP是一种嵌入在HTML中的脚本语言,可以与HTML代码无缝结合。您可以使用任何文本编辑器编写PHP代码,并将其保存为.php文件。在PHP文件中,您可以使用各种PHP函数和语法来实现不同的功能,例如数据库连接、数据查询、表单处理等。

第五步是测试站点的功能。在编写完PHP代码后,您可以在浏览器中访问您的站点,检查是否能够正常运行。如果出现错误,您可以查看错误日志来找出问题所在,并对代码进行调试。

第六步是发布站点。当您完成了站点的开发和测试后,您可以将站点部署到生产环境中。如果您选择使用云服务器,您可以使用FTP或者SSH等工具将文件上传到服务器上。如果您选择在本地搭建服务器,您可以使用域名解析将您的站点与公网IP地址绑定。

第七步是维护和更新站点。建立一个PHP站点并不是一次性的任务,您需要不断地维护和更新站点,以确保其正常运行和安全性。您可以定期备份数据库,更新服务器软件,修复漏洞等。

建立一个PHP站点需要选择合适的开发环境,安装所需的软件,配置服务器和数据库,编写PHP代码,测试站点的功能,发布站点,以及维护和更新站点。希望这篇文章能够帮助您建立自己的PHP站点,祝您成功!

通过本文对phpcms站点目录结构的详解,我们了解到了phpcms是一个功能强大的内容管理系统,它的目录结构清晰且具有一定的灵活性。在根目录下,我们可以找到一些核心文件和目录,如application、phpcms、static等。其中,application目录包含了站点的应用程序文件,phpcms目录包含了系统的核心文件,static目录则存放了一些静态资源文件。还有一些重要的目录如template、upload、cache等,它们分别用于存放模板文件、上传的文件和系统缓存文件。通过深入了解phpcms的目录结构,我们可以更好地理解和使用这个强大的内容管理系统,为网站的开发和维护提供了便利。

相关文章